Artist's Description

While on a nature walk in August 2020, I spotted these two honeybees as they visited California poppies.

Even in the midst of unprecedented smoke from wildfires burning in Northern California, I marveled at how they were busy about their daily tasks.

Honeybees are amazing creatures.

As with all of nature, they are a reflection of the character and integrity of the Creator.

Yes, they give us benefits, such as pollinating one-third of our crops and making honey.

They are also equipped with stingers to protect themselves and their hive.

There is a benefit ~ but there is also a warning.
